Course Details

• Energy Transition and Decarbonization: Understanding the global energy landscape, the need for transition, and the role of technology innovations in reducing carbon emissions.
• Renewable Energy Technologies: Exploring solar, wind, hydro, geothermal, and biomass energy sources, their advantages, challenges, and innovations shaping their future.
• Energy Storage and Grid Management: Examining various energy storage technologies, grid modernization, and demand-side management for a stable, reliable, and resilient energy infrastructure.
• Clean Energy Policy and Regulation: Investigating the policy and regulatory landscape, their impact on energy technology innovations, and strategies for successful implementation.
• Energy Efficiency and Demand-side Management: Delving into energy-efficient technologies, systems, and best practices, and their role in reducing energy consumption and costs.
• Innovation Management and Entrepreneurship: Fostering an innovation ecosystem, cultivating entrepreneurial mindsets, and addressing market needs for successful energy technology commercialization.
• Advanced Energy Systems and Digitalization: Investigating the role of digital solutions, AI, IoT, and machine learning in enhancing energy systems' performance, monitoring, and control.
• Financing and Investment in Clean Energy: Exploring financial mechanisms, funding opportunities, and investment strategies to scale up clean energy projects and technologies.
• Sustainability and Environmental Impact: Evaluating the environmental impact of energy technologies, their role in achieving sustainability goals, and the importance of circular economy principles.

Career Path

In today's rapidly evolving energy landscape, professionals with expertise in Energy Technology Innovations are highly sought after. Here are some emerging roles and their respective market shares, illustrated through a 3D pie chart: 1. **Renewable Energy Engineer**: These professionals design, develop, and maintain renewable energy systems, including solar, wind, and hydroelectric power. A 35% share in the energy technology job market highlights the increasing demand for clean energy solutions. 2. **Energy Storage Specialist**: As the importance of grid stability, peak demand management, and energy security rises, so does the need for Energy Storage Specialists with expertise in batteries, capacitors, and other storage technologies. 3. **Smart Grid Architect**: These professionals design and implement intelligent power distribution systems, integrating advanced sensors, communication networks, and analytics to optimize energy consumption and reduce environmental footprints. 4. **Energy Analyst**: These experts collect, analyze, and interpret data, playing a critical role in decision-making, policy development, and market analysis for energy companies. 5. **Energy Technology Innovation Manager**: Driving innovation in energy technology, these professionals coordinate research and development initiatives, manage intellectual property, and facilitate partnerships with industry stakeholders, startups, and academia. The energy technology sector is teeming with opportunities, and the roles presented here are just a glimpse of the diverse career paths available. As the global community continues to shift towards cleaner, more sustainable energy sources, the demand for professionals with expertise in these areas is projected to grow.
